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Malagasy civet | sola pith |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om | Animalia (Animals) | Plantae (Plants) |
| Phylum | Chordata (Chordates) | Magnoliophyta (Flowering Plants) |
| Class | Mammalia (Mammals) | Magnoliopsida (Dicots) |
| Order | Carnivora (Carnivorans) | Fabales (Legumes & Allies) |
| Family | Eupleridae | Fabaceae |
| Genus | Fossa | Aeschynomene |
| Species | Fossa fossana | Aeschynomene afraspera |
